About Orderly Network

Orderly is the infrastructure that enables people to trade anything, anywhere, through a permissionless liquidity layer. It provides deep, unified liquidity across all blockchains via a single order book. Orderly ensures strong liquidity on major chains, including Solana, Sonic, Arbitrum, Base, Mantle, Ethereum Mainnet, Optimism, and Polygon. It offers traders and exchanges access to over 100 markets through its unified trading infrastructure.

About Solana

SOL is the native token of Solana, an open source project which implements a new, high-performance, permission less blockchain. It is also the fastest blockchain in the world and the fastest growing ecosystem in crypto, with over 400 projects spanning DeFi, NFTs, Web3 and more. The architecture of their blockchain are build based on Proof of History (PoH); a proof for verifying order and passage of time between events.
